The high-street retailer are branching out, into the electronics range, as we saw recently with their iPod-integrated men’s suit. From this month, they’ll be selling their own brand of LCD TVs, ranging from 15″ for £179, to 32″ at £549. Never fear, HD fans, as the 19″ and 32″ models are HD ready.
